Strategies for Cracking “Totes Absurd” Clues
Now that you understand what these clues are all about, how do you actually solve them? Here’s a strategic approach to cracking these head-scratchers:
Read the Clue Carefully: The First Step
This might seem obvious, but the first step is to read the clue *carefully*. Pay attention to every word, every nuance. Look for potential double meanings, hints, and any clues that could guide you to the solution. Sometimes, re-reading the clue aloud helps you to hear the potential wordplay.
Consider Wordplay & Alternative Meanings: The Second Approach
When you encounter a “Totes Absurd” clue, immediately consider if wordplay is in play. Think of alternative meanings and associations, or look for similarities in sound. Think of words that sound similar, or words that could be used as a pun.
Look for Hints in Surrounding Clues
Examine the crosswords grid itself. Are there letters already filled in? These can be crucial hints. Consider the number of letters the answer requires. The intersection of clues can also provide valuable hints. The grid often gives you context.
Utilize Existing Letters
Use any existing letters you have in your crossword grid. If you have a few letters of an answer already filled in, this can make the clue much easier to solve. If you already have a few letters filled, this can help you identify the type of wordplay being used.
Consider Your Knowledge of Pop Culture and Current Events
Think about what you know about the news, entertainment, social media, and trends. Is there a current event or a pop culture reference that might be related to the clue? If you are stuck, think if there are any obvious answers that might be hidden in a pop culture reference.
Don’t Be Afraid to Guess (Lightly)
When you’re stuck, sometimes a calculated guess is the best course of action. Pencil in a potential answer lightly, then move on to other clues. If other clues intersect with the answer, you might be able to confirm or eliminate your guess later. You can always erase it.
